Indeed there is, but its hosted in Guildford.... obviously...

Its the Aldershot Branch of the British Model Soldier Society rather than a traditional wargames show, meaing its mostly large scale display models. However, they are widening thier audience to more gaming hence our involvement last year and this. The guy came to the Guildford club tonight to ask if we would be there again ourselves.

Its only a month away (march 2nd I think), but that seems typical. Its a small event and to be honest poorly organised, but dont let that detract from the level of painters it attracts. I did a hobby Brush Gallery for it last year: http://hobbybrush.com/historical/historicalmisc/abbmss/

I talked to JoeK at his stand there last year (assuming you're JoeK of JoeK miniatures... ). Cant imagine its a big money spinner for 28 and below, but its worth a look.
